Wyo Limited Liability Company Search Benefits
A Wyo LLC inquiry offers several benefits for business owners and business owners looking to form a limited liability company. One of the main advantages is the strong privacy protections provided by the state law. The state does not require the disclosure of members’ identities in public records, allowing business owners to maintain a higher level of privacy. This can be especially appealing for people seeking to protect their privacy and minimize public exposure.
Additionally, important benefit of conducting a Wyoming Limited Liability Company search is the friendly business environment. The state is well-known for its minimal formation and maintenance fees, as well as its absence of a tax on LLCs. This means that companies can run with lower overhead costs, making it an attractive option for new businesses and existing companies alike. The efficient digital search tools provided by the state make it easy to access important information about current LLCs and to ensure adherence with state regulations.

Texas LLC Search Process
As establishing a company in Texas, carrying out a comprehensive LLC search is essential to confirm your preferred business name is available and complies with all state regulations. The Secretary of State of Texas offers an web-based tool that allows you to search for already registered LLC titles. Through visiting the Secretary of State website, you can enter the title you wish to use and verify whether it is taken by someone else. This initial step helps avoid any legal complications and ensures that your business can function effectively from the start.
Once you have confirmed that your desired title is unclaimed, you can gather important information about existing Limited Liability Companies in the state. The search results provide insights into the condition of a business, its establishment date, and its registered agent. This data can be beneficial not only for verifying the status of your business name but also for understanding your rivals' activities and organization within the state of Texas market.
Upon completion of the search, when you discover an suitable name, the next step is to submit the Formation Certificate with the Texas Secretary of State. This form officially registers your LLC and contains necessary details such as the title of the business, the duration of the LLC, the address, and the registered agent's information. Completing these steps will put you on the path to successfully forming your Texan Limited Liability Company.
New York LLC Inquiry Criteria
To execute an inquiry into LLCs in NY, people can utilize the New York Department of State's Corporations Division web-based portal. This platform provides an accessible way to access data about licensed limited liability companies in the state. Participants will need to enter particular information, such as the LLC name or the entity’s identification number, in order to retrieve pertinent information. It is essential to have precise information to ensure a effective inquiry.
The New York Limited Liability Company search procedure allows you to verify the status of a business entity, check registered titles, and review the filing history. This can be particularly beneficial for entrepreneurs seeking to start a fresh Limited Liability Company and confirm that their desired business name is open. Additionally, the query outcomes can provide information into any possible obligations or concerns associated with former companies, which can guide crucial business decisions.
